Xaxis Malaysia promotes Asha Nair to lead operations

share on

Xaxis has appointed Asha Nair as director, Xaxis Malaysia. In her new role, she will be responsible for the overall day to day management of the Xaxis business in Malaysia.Xaxis Malaysia was established in 2012, and its clients include the likes of Shell, GSK, Lenovo and Astro, amongst others.Arshan Saha, vice president, Xaxis Southeast Asia, will continue to oversee the market as part of his regional purview.Prior to joining Xaxis, Nair was head of interaction (Digital) for Mediacom Malaysia where she was responsible for the management, leadership and establishment of the agency’s digital offerings. She has over 13 years of experience in the area of digital marketing and advertising.Senior manager of operations, Ai Ping Kui will also be promoted to director of operations, Xaxis Malaysia.She will be reporting to Asha Nair. Ai Ping has been with Xaxis Malaysia for the last three years. Prior to Xaxis, she was with Catcha Digital and LG Electronics and has more than 10 years of experience in the digital media arena in Malaysia. In her new role, she will oversee the operational aspects of client campaigns and publisher management.“It is great to have such a top-shelf team at our Malaysia operations. The appointments further strengthen Xaxis Malaysia’s pole position in the programmatic and digital media space. Each of the team members brings a wealth of experience from their previous roles,” said Saha.“At Xaxis, we have always taken pride in our ability to not only acquire top talent but to also to retain them. The company believes in promoting from within as our people live and breathe Xaxis values, a trait we value,” said Michel de Rijk, CEO, Xaxis Asia Pacific.“We have a world class network in Asia and we are constantly looking at ways to strengthen and improve our offering so as to ensure we meet our clients’ expectations and stay ahead of the curve,” added de Rijk.“I am delighted with the appointments and am confident that both Asha and Ai Ping in their new roles will add even more value in helping our clients achieve their business goals,” said Girish Menon, CEO, GroupM Malaysia.
